Importance of Refine Optimization



Optimizing waste water therapy processes via thorough process optimization is important for maximizing performance and making certain ecological sustainability. By fine-tuning each step of the treatment procedure, from preliminary intake to last discharge, water treatment facilities can attain higher levels of impurity removal, reduce power consumption, and decrease the generation of waste byproducts. Process optimization entails examining essential performance indications, such as hydraulic retention times, sludge retention times, and nutrient levels, to recognize locations for improvement and apply targeted options.


Efficient procedure optimization not only boosts the general efficiency of waste water therapy plants however also adds to cost financial savings and regulative compliance. By optimizing procedures, operators can attain higher therapy capabilities without the need for substantial infrastructure investments. In addition, enhanced therapy efficiency brings about cleaner effluent discharge, decreasing the ecological effect on getting water bodies and communities.

Advanced Treatment Technologies



In the world of drainage treatment, the application of advanced treatment modern technologies plays a pivotal function in boosting the overall effectiveness and performance of the treatment processes. These sophisticated technologies use cutting-edge solutions to attend to intricate contaminants present in wastewater streams, making sure the removal of pollutants to satisfy rigid water top quality standards. Advanced treatment processes such as membrane layer bioreactors, ozonation, progressed oxidation procedures, and turn around osmosis enable the detailed removal of pollutants, including emerging contaminants like drugs and individual care products.


Furthermore, these innovations help with resource healing by drawing out important materials such as phosphorus, nitrogen, and energy from the wastewater. Progressed nutrient elimination modern technologies can recuperate phosphorus and nitrogen for reuse in agricultural fertilizers, while energy recuperation systems like anaerobic food digestion can harness biogas for electrical energy generation. By integrating sophisticated treatment modern technologies right into wastewater treatment plants, operators can boost water top quality, minimize environmental impact, and relocate towards a more resource-efficient and lasting technique to wastewater management.


Source Healing Techniques





Resource recuperation techniques in wastewater treatment procedures play an essential function in maximizing the use of beneficial resources included within wastewater streams. One usual source recovery method is the removal of nutrients like phosphorus and nitrogen from wastewater for reuse as plant foods or in industrial processes.


Water healing methods, such as membrane layer technologies and advanced filtering systems, allow the therapy and reuse of water for non-potable applications like watering or commercial processes. By executing resource healing methods in wastewater therapy plants, not just can beneficial resources be conserved and reused, but the general sustainability and effectiveness of the therapy procedure can be substantially boosted. As the emphasis on source deficiency and ecological sustainability proceeds to expand, the relevance of incorporating source recuperation strategies into wastewater therapy procedures comes to be significantly noticeable.
